The story of Rebekah Cook began in 1763 in Livingston, Essex, New Jersey, United States. In 1830, Rebekah Cook resided in Livingston, Essex, New Jersey, USA. In 1843, Rebekah Cook resided in New York City, New York, USA. Rebekah Cook married Moses Ely, and had children including Abram Halsey Ely, Anna Maria Ely, Benjamin Ely, Elizabeth Ely, Epaphras Cook Ely, John Ely, Moses Ely, Sarah Ely, Smith Ely. Rebekah Cook passed away in 1852 in Livingston, Essex County, New Jersey, United States of America.
